    Structural modelling of US Oil's Hot Creek Valley Prospect by Baker Hughes is
    complete.  The Board and the Company's technical team are now studying the
    findings, and further details will be communicated to shareholders in due
    course. In the meantime, Baker Hughes' revised Oil-In-Place estimates can be
    reported.  These are a significant upgrade on the previous estimates reported
    in 2013.

    For four zones of the Tertiary Eblana Structure, Oil-In-Place estimates and
    Recoverable Oil are as follows:

                                              OOIP (MMBBl)               
                                                                         
                                  Low case      Best case     High case  
                                                                         
    TZ1                                   185           677          1214
                                                                         
    TZ2                                     8            29            58
                                                                         
    TZ3                                     9            40            83
                                                                         
    TZ4                                    72           271           539
                                                                         
    OOIP (millions barrels)               274          1017          1894
                                                                         
    TOTAL RECOVERABLE                    54.8         203.4         378.8
    CONTINGENT OIL RESOURCES                                             
    (millions bbls                                                       
    at 20% recoverability)                                               

    Zones TZ2 and TZ4 flowed oil on previous tests.

    Background
    In 2016 the Company contracted Halliburton to carry out a Vertical Seismic
    Profile (VSP) survey based on US Oil's Eblana #1 discovery well, and Baker
    Hughes (BHI) to carry out structural modelling based on all the available data
    including VSP. The purpose of the structural modelling was to reduce risk as
    far as possible before the Company carries out its plan to re-enter the Eblana
    #1 well and sidetrack to identified targets. In addition, Baker Hughes
    calculated the revised Oil-In-Place estimates reported above for the Tertiary
    Structure updip of the Eblana #1 well.  These estimates do not include the
    Palaeozoic strata, which may also be highly prospective.  Baker Hughes is
    currently working on revised Oil-In-Place estimates for the Company's full 88
    sq km lease acreage, and these will be reported in due course.

    About U.S. Oil & Gas:

    U.S. Oil & Gas plc is an oil and gas exploration company with a strategy to
    identify and acquire oil and gas assets in the early phase of the upstream
    life-cycle and mature them. The Company's main asset is in Nye County, Nevada
    where it holds the entire share capital of US-based company, Major Oil
    International LLC ("Major Oil"). Major Oil has acquired rights to exploration
    and development acreage in Hot Creek Valley, Nye County, adjacent to the oil
    and gas rich Railroad Valley area of Nevada, both of which are part of the
    Sevier Thrust of central Nevada and western Utah, USA.
